LOUISVILLE, Ky. (WDRB) — Authorities have identified both men who were killed in a shooting in Old Louisville earlier this week. 

Louisville Police responded to a report of a shooting around 1:15 a.m. Monday in the 100 block of West Oak Street.

When officers arrived, they found two men suffering from gunshot wounds. Police also located a woman who had been shot in the 500 block of West St. Catherine Street, and believe her injuries are connected to the shooting on West Oak Street.

All three victims were taken to UofL Hospital.

The two men were listed in critical condition, while the woman was believed to have non-life-threatening injuries. Shortly after arriving the the hospital, one of the men died from their injuries.

Police confirmed Monday evening the second man in critical condition also died at the hospital from his injuries.

Friday, the Jefferson County Coroner's Office identified both men as 32-year-old Devante Shields, of Louisville, and Lavonta Churchill. 

LMPD's Homicide Unit is leading the investigation. No suspects have been identified, and no arrests have been made.
